Telecom / Data Platform

CEIR Platform

Ruby on Rails PostgreSQL Apache Kafka Apache Spark Docker CI/CD

Central Equipment Identity Register platform processing national-scale device registration data across multiple mobile network operators. The system ingests high-volume data streams, enforces regulatory compliance, and serves real-time query APIs to carriers and regulators.

Data Scale

High-volume device registration pipelines ingesting data from multiple network operators

Performance

Query optimisation and indexing strategies to maintain low-latency reads on large datasets

Observability

Structured logging, metrics dashboards, and alerting to keep pipeline health visible

Deployment

Containerised services with automated CI/CD enabling confident, zero-downtime releases

Engineering challenges

  • Designing fault-tolerant data ingestion pipelines that handle upstream inconsistencies from multiple operators without data loss or silent corruption
  • Keeping query latency acceptable as dataset size grew — required deliberate schema evolution, targeted indexing, and query plan analysis
  • Building observability from scratch so on-call engineers could diagnose issues without needing deep system knowledge
  • Shipping infrastructure changes (Dockerisation, pipeline refactors) without disrupting live data flows or creating deployment risk
Fintech / Payments

Payment Gateway

Ruby on Rails PostgreSQL Docker CI/CD RSpec

Production payment processing system handling real financial transactions with strict reliability and compliance requirements. Led a team of engineers owning the full development lifecycle — from feature delivery to incident response.

Team Leadership

Led and mentored engineers through feature delivery, code review, and incident management

Reliability

Designed for fault isolation and recovery — failed transactions never silently corrupt state

CI/CD

Automated pipelines with comprehensive test suites the team could deploy from confidently multiple times daily

Compliance

Audit trails, idempotency guarantees, and data integrity constraints to meet regulatory requirements

Engineering challenges

  • Ensuring idempotency across payment flows so retries and network failures never cause duplicate charges or inconsistent ledger state
  • Building CI pipelines rigorous enough that engineers trusted automated tests over manual verification before every deploy
  • Maintaining comprehensive audit trails for every state transition to satisfy compliance and support internal investigations
  • Leading incident response under pressure — diagnosing production issues quickly while keeping stakeholders informed and minimising blast radius
Fintech / Investment Platform

Robo-Advisory Platform

Ruby on Rails PostgreSQL AWS Packwerk RSpec

German investment platform offering clients visibility into and control over their ETF portfolios. Contributed to the client-facing Rails application across portfolio management, infrastructure migration to AWS, and an architectural shift toward a modular monolith — operating within a regulated European financial environment with strict requirements around data accuracy, auditability, and client trust.

Portfolio Management

Built portfolio rebalancing logic and a portfolio performance API requiring precise financial calculations and data accuracy

Observability

Drove comprehensive logging implementation as part of the AWS infrastructure migration team, improving production visibility in the new environment

Client Experience

Developed user management features and integrated Trustpilot to surface and manage client reviews within the platform

Architecture

Part of the team beginning a Packwerk-driven modular monolith transition to enforce package boundaries and improve long-term maintainability

Engineering challenges

  • Implementing portfolio rebalancing with the correctness guarantees a regulated investment product demands — wrong calculations have direct financial consequences for clients
  • Building the portfolio performance API to return accurate, consistent results across different time horizons and portfolio compositions
  • Establishing structured logging during the AWS migration to give the team meaningful production visibility without disrupting ongoing delivery
  • Navigating a Packwerk modular monolith migration — enforcing package boundaries in a large Rails codebase while keeping feature work moving
